Josh writes, I eat a healthy diet, but I tend to eat the same foods over and over again.

0:27.0

For example, I eat spinach every day for lunch.

0:30.0

I know a varied diet is supposed to be best.

0:33.0

Can some healthy foods be bad for you if you consume them too frequently?

0:37.0

Josh is right, a varied diet is usually touted as the ideal.

0:42.0

But why? After all, the ability to choose from a wide

0:46.2

variety of foods no matter where we live or what time of the year it happens to be,

0:50.5

is to a certain extent a modern luxury. Many of our primitive ancestors thrived

0:56.5

an extremely limited diets that might have included just one or two protein

1:01.3

sources, a single type of grain, and a small selection of local

1:05.2

seasonal fruits and vegetables.

1:07.4

And in fact, these indigenous diets are often held up as being far superior to the modern diet with all its variety.

1:14.8

So why is there all this emphasis on a varied diet?

1:18.3

For those who would prefer to keep it simple, couldn't you just come up with one healthy meal plan and eat it every day?

1:25.0

Although it's clearly not essential, a varied diet does offer at least two advantages.

1:31.0

First, eating a variety of foods helps ensure that you're covering

1:35.4

your bases nutritionally. Green peppers, for example, are a terrific source of

1:39.2

Vitamin C, but don't offer that much in the way of Vitamin A, whereas carrots are the other way around.
